By D. Kuhn, et. al.,
Specialist Indexing in Oracle Database 11g is ready the single database constitution on the center of virtually all functionality issues: the index. Database procedure functionality is among the best issues in details expertise at the present time. directors fight to take care of with the explosion of entry and job pushed by means of the proliferation of computing into every thing from telephones to drugs to computers in our more and more attached international. on the center of any good-performing database lies a valid indexing procedure that makes acceptable use of indexing, and particularly of the vendor-specific indexing positive factors on offer.
Few databases totally make the most the wealth of knowledge entry mechanisms supplied by way of Oracle. professional Indexing in Oracle Database 11g is helping through bringing jointly details indexing and the way to take advantage of it into one, handy and blissfully brief quantity so that you can learn speedy and feature at your fingertips for reference. study the different sorts of indices to be had and whilst each one is healthier utilized. realize whilst queries aren’t utilizing indices as you plan. deal with your indexing for max functionality. enable specialist Indexing in Oracle Database 11g be your consultant to deep mastery of the main primary functionality optimization constitution in Oracle Database.
Explains how indices paintings, how they assist, and the way they hinder
Demystifies some of the index choices
Describes the database management chores linked to indices
What you’ll learn
Create an total indexing technique to advisor your decisions
Choose the right kind indexing mechanisms in your applications
Manage and hold indices to prevent degradation and safeguard efficiency
Take higher good thing about underused index kinds equivalent to index-organized tables
Choose the best columns to index, with confidence
Blend partitioning and materialized perspectives into your indexing method
Read or Download Expert Indexing in Oracle DB 11g - Max. Perf. for Your DB PDF
Best oracle books
This SpringerBrief explains the best way to create a Rails internet program with JRuby, a a hundred% Java implementation for Ruby. This short demonstrates how Oracle® WebLogic servers and JBoss® program servers set up the JRuby program, how JRuby runs at the Java® digital computing device, and the way JRuby is the foundation for well known web content together with LinkedIn, Oracle combine, and Mingle.
SQL is the ANSI-standard language for having access to and manipulating relational databases. somebody (programmers, directors, or designers) who paintings with a relational databases have to comprehend the SQL language. whereas such a lot books out there don't adequately disguise the fundamentals, this e-book differs: it explains basics intimately, supported by way of lifelike examples.
This publication is a short consultant to getting begun with Oracle company Intelligence SE platform that may resolution universal enterprise questions and assist you make speedy enterprise judgements. The examples during this e-book may also help you arrange the database for research and create enterprise stories very quickly. when you are an enterprise analyst, a document builder, a DBA, or an program developer who desires to find out how to use the Oracle enterprise Intelligence platform for research and reporting, this can be the suitable publication for you.
So it’s time to improve Oracle Database to model 12c and also you have to select the proper approach whereas contemplating matters resembling downtime. This e-book explains all the to be had improve and migration equipment so that you can select the person who matches your atmosphere. you can be conscious of the sensible concerns and proactive measures to take to improve effectively and decrease unforeseen matters.
- Optimizing Oracle Performance
- Oracle Programming: A Primer, Version 7.0
- Oracle Database 10g New Features
- Mastering Oracle SQL and SQL*Plus
- Oracle Database 11g Administrator Certified Professional Study Guide
Additional resources for Expert Indexing in Oracle DB 11g - Max. Perf. for Your DB
If it’s not possible to thoroughly test, then consider doing one of the following before dropping: • Enable monitoring for the index. • Make the index invisible. • Make the index unusable. The idea is to try to determine beforehand that the index is not used for any purpose before actually dropping it. See Chapter 7 for details on monitoring an index. Monitoring an index will give you an idea if the application is using it for SELECT statements. Index monitoring will not tell you if the index is used for other internal purposes, like enforcing a constraint or preventing locking issues.
The key (constraint) is the business rule being enforced. Creating B-tree Index on Primary Key Columns A primary key constraint guarantees that values in a column (or combination of columns) can be used to always uniquely identify a record within a table. There can be only one primary key constraint per table. A primary key constraint can’t contain null values. You can think of a primary key constraint as a combination of unique and not null constraints. There are several good reasons to create a primary key index for each table.
Create index emp_fk1 on emp(dept_id); You should be able to independently run the prior two delete statements. When you have a B-tree index on the foreign key columns, if deleting from the child table, Oracle will not excessively lock all rows in the parent table. Summary B-tree indexes are the default index type used in Oracle databases. For most applications, B-tree indexes are sufficient. With high cardinality columns, a B-tree index will usually provide considerable performance benefits. 47 CHAPTER 2 ■ B-TREE INDEXES When creating an index, we recommend that you place the index in a tablespace separate from its corresponding table.
Expert Indexing in Oracle DB 11g - Max. Perf. for Your DB by D. Kuhn, et. al.,